Evidently, you received the sample MS Access database that I sent you. I figured this would help you out - if you're lost, feel free to send me an e-mail. I downloaded your complete songbook (all versions) from your website and you obviously know something about MS Access. Basically, the solution to your original question is to "flag" your dupes, make a query that retrieves the non-dupes and make a report using that query as the record source.
You've certainly helped me out too, although not as a direct response to a question I asked. I downloaded AUDIOGRABBER based on YOUR recommendation as I needed a way to rip to BIN from a multi-session disc.
Once again, if you have any questions concerning MS Access e-mail me. If you have your dupes "flagged" like I assume you do the solution to your question is very simple.
